Despite their many strengths, Sun in Libra Moon in Leo individuals may face certain challenges that can impact their personal and professional lives. One of the main challenges is their need for validation and appreciation. They may become overly reliant on external approval, which can lead to feelings of insecurity if they do not receive the recognition they desire.

To understand the Sun in Libra Moon in Leo combination, we must first delve into the characteristics of each sign involved. Libra, an air sign ruled by Venus, is known for its focus on balance, justice, and relationships. It is often associated with diplomacy, charm, and a strong sense of fairness. On the other hand, Leo, a fire sign ruled by the Sun itself, signifies creativity, leadership, and an exuberant personality. The Moon in Leo adds an emotional depth, encouraging the need to feel appreciated and admired.
